Sweeping changes aimed at Kentucky aid programs called 'war on poor'

Deborah Yetter
February 25, 2019
The Courier-Journal

Top House Republicans have filed a bill that would enact sweeping changes in Kentucky's system of public benefits — including Medicaid, food stamps and temporary cash aid for the poor — adding work requirements, drug tests and benefit cuts that opponents say would be disastrous.

"This is the most severe attack on Kentucky's safety net in our state's history," said Dustin Pugel, a policy analyst with the Kentucky Center for Economic Policy. "I've never seen anything like this.

"This is the war on the poor," he said.
